Transaction 73bbd641407e3c4a1382625993315f981f8e887b405c39b66224a1404a0259ab
1 Input
1 Output
-
73bbd641407e3c4a1382625993315f981f8e887b405c39b66224a1404a0259ab:0
- value
- 55778
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3ea408687111ca4985b404fb1facd16ae9d8331
- address
- bc1qu04ypp58zyw2fxzmgp8mr7kdz6hfmqe3tv8ejs